[ubuntu] Publish new Kernel in Grub (1.99) Menu

$
0
0
Hi,

I installed Ubuntu Server 12.04 LTS and configured a Software-RAID during setup (md) to use both of my SSDs.

Grub says it is version 1.99. Now I installed the new kernel to fix TRIM-support and support for my graphics card. I followed this guide: http://www.upubuntu.com/2013/04/inst...el-386-in.html and ran

Code:

sudo update-grub
but the entries won't show up. In the grub.cfg I can find all entries I want.

What do I need to do to make the kernel bootable? Manual editing in Grub did not help.
